Design and Usability
The Arlo Essential Indoor Security Camera features a sleek and modern design, easily mounted in various locations around the home. It comes with a 6.5 ft power cable, allowing for versatile placement without the hassle of battery changes. The WEMOH camera, with its patent-pending magnetic design, is built for quick attachment and detachment from a magnetic mount in your car. This design addresses common frustrations parents face with traditional baby monitors.
While both cameras offer user-friendly experiences, the Arlo excels in home settings with its dual-band Wi-Fi connectivity and compatibility with smart home assistants. Conversely, the WEMOH camera is tailored for car use, ensuring easy setup and storage when not in use, making it particularly convenient for parents on the go.
Video Quality
In terms of video quality, the Arlo Essential Indoor Security Camera boasts a crystal-clear 2K resolution, which is ideal for monitoring your child's activities with detail. This high resolution allows for clear identification of movements, whether it’s a baby stirring in a crib or a toddler wandering around.
On the other hand, the WEMOH camera offers true 1080P resolution, which is also commendable but does not quite reach the level of detail provided by the Arlo. The WEMOH's display adjusts brightness from 10% to 100%, ensuring visibility in various lighting conditions, but the Arlo's superior resolution might be more beneficial for indoor monitoring.
Special Features
The Arlo Essential Indoor Security Camera includes several advanced features that enhance its functionality. It offers person recognition, automated sound detection for important alerts, and a one-month trial of the Arlo Secure plan, which includes emergency response services. These features provide comprehensive monitoring and peace of mind for parents.
In comparison, the WEMOH NO.1 camera focuses on usability in a car setting. It includes a zoom function and a mirror mode to ensure parents can easily see their child seated in a rear-facing position. Additionally, it features auto night vision with advanced light sensors, allowing for clear visibility even in low-light conditions. While both cameras have unique features, the Arlo’s offerings are more geared toward home security.
